machinery (Noun (Uncountable))
Machinery refers to machines collectively or the internal working parts of a machine. It can also describe the organized systems and procedures used by an organization or government to function.
Think of 'Machine' + 'ery'. The 'ery' is like 'bakery' or 'scenery'—it describes a place or a collection of things.
The machineries are new. → The machinery is new.
I bought a machinery. → I bought a piece of machinery.
